American Tradition Series
We offer the standard raised panel, ranch panel and flush steel doors that have
been the standard in the garage door industry for thirty years. These steel doors
come in non-insulated and insulated versions, and are available in a variety of
colors and with a variety of window options. These doors can be ordered in widths
up to 20’ wide and 12’ high. The American Tradition Series features traditional
appearance, but some models feature new technology, including safety features such
as pinch resistant joint profiles, safety enclosed springs and anti-drop devices,
which safely stop the door in the event of a broken spring.

STEP 1
Measure existing Door width and height in feet
and inches. This determines the size of door needed. The finished opening should
be the same size as the door.
STEP 2
Measure for sideroom: 5 1/4" is required on each side for
installation of the vertical track.
STEP 3
Measure area labeled 'Headroom - distance between the top of the
door opening ("jamb header") and the ceiling (or floor joist). 12"
is required for standard torsion spring or Torquemaster tm counter balance system.
If you have restricted headroom, special hardware is available. Farmer Overhead
Door Company specializes in the conversion of one piece doors to sectional doors
and can fit a door and operator in as little as 5".
NOTE: If door height extends above the opening, the headroom measurement
should be adjusted proportionately.
STEP 4
Measure area labeled "backroom" - distance
is measured from the garage door opening toward the back wall of the garage. Door
height plus 18" is required. When installing a garage door opener, the door
height plus 3 1/2' is the typical necessary backroom.
